I worked extra hard on my food intake yesterday and I added a Whey protein powder concentrate to my morning because when I was planning my meals for the day, they came out to a kind of sad 50g, so I also tossed in some sardines. So at the end of the day we had grilled salmon for dinner and it was a hefty 8 ounces and it took up so much of my plate, it bothered me that FS was showing it as only 11.03 grams of protein, which was the reason I added more protein to my earlier meals. I decided to check further and low and behold, 8 ounces of Salmon has 46g of protein....not 11.03. Salmon is something I recently added to my diet that I had never really tried in the past. I encourage all FS users to double check foods that you enter if you are using it for meal planning, because not all of the information is correct.
